This summer, soccer enthusiasts have a chance to test their predictive powers with The Athletic’s World Cup pick’em game. Participants can attempt to surpass expert writers, a data algorithm, or even a playful contender, Stanley the dog.

In this interactive challenge, you will make daily predictions across 104 World Cup games to create the longest possible winning streak. Your streak continues as long as you get your picks correct but resets with each incorrect prediction, giving you the opportunity to start fresh and build a new streak.

How to Participate

The objective is simple: predict consecutive tournament matches correctly. Each correct pick adds to your streak, with the aim of building the most extended streak among participants.

When a prediction fails, your streak ends. You then have the opportunity to start over and aim for a new personal best streak.

Compete with Experts

Within the pick’em hub, you can track your performance against The Athletic’s soccer experts, Elias Burke and Andy Jones. They will provide daily predictions backed by detailed articles explaining their thought process for each game.

Participants will also compete against special guest predictors, such as Wilf, a keen six-year-old soccer fan, Stanley, the dog, The Algo prediction machine, and a rotating selection of other subscribers. You can access the leaderboard at any time to check who holds the current record for the longest streak.
